Ethnomethodology is usually a descriptive discipline and won’t engage in the explanation or evaluation of the particular social order undertaken as a topic of review. Ethnomethodology is one way for understanding this social orders people use to create sense of the world through analysing their particular accounts and descriptions of these day-to-day experiences.
